The release date of ‘The Green Knight’, starring British actor Dev Patel, Alicia Vikander, Joel Edgerton, and Sean Harris, has postponed due to the recent surge in coronavirus cases in the United Kingdom. It was scheduled to release on July 30.  The film will release as scheduled in the United States.

In the film, Dev Patel plays the role of Sir Gawain and Ralph Ineson plays the titular role of ‘The Green Knight’. A24 films released a minute-long video clip ‘Christ is Born’ on YouTube on Friday. The film is based on Arthurian Legend, a fantasy adventure film highly praised for its beautiful visuals, diverse story and fantastic performance by the cast.
